Amar Chitra Katha, one of India’s most loved comic book brands, is set to bring India’s two great epics, the Ramayana and the Mahabharata, to Mumbai Comic Con 2026 through a special fan experience designed for readers, collectors, families, and comic-book enthusiasts. At an event known for global pop culture, manga, anime, superheroes, gaming, and fandom-led experiences, Amar Chitra Katha will present stories from the Indian epics in a format that encourages visitors to engage with the characters, conflicts, and ideas that have shaped generations of Indian readers. The brand will also launch Tinkle Holiday Special 56 at the event, with the Tinkle editorial team present for the release. The new edition is expected to draw young readers as well as long-time Tinkle fans who have grown up with its characters. In addition, Amar Chitra Katha will be announcing its upcoming book live on stage, giving fans an exclusive first look at what’s next from the brand. Amar Chitra Katha will also host a live on-stage quiz titled “Faceoff Quiz: Heroes vs Anti-Heroes of the Ramayana and Mahabharata.” Open to audience members, the quiz will invite fans to test their knowledge of the two epics and compete for exclusive goodies. Visitors can also explore new products at the Amar Chitra Katha booth, including the first-ever Ramayana Chest, a premium collector’s edition wooden box. New merchandise and games will also be available at the event. Fans will have the chance to meet members of the Amar Chitra Katha and Tinkle creative teams. Savio Mascarenhas, Group Art Director, will be present at the Artist Gallery for book signings. Gayathri Chandrasekaran, Editor-in-Chief of Tinkle, will be available on Day 1 for fan interactions and signings. Amar Chitra Katha’s presence at Mumbai Comic Con 2026 comes at a time when Indian comics, mythology-led publishing, and homegrown pop culture are finding fresh relevance among young audiences and collectors. At the event, the brand will represent a distinctly Indian voice within a wider fan culture dominated by international franchises.
